College Applications sessions are for high school seniors in their fall semester who are applying to one of more undergraduate schools, or for current undergraduate students hoping to advance to graduate school. I recommend booking these sessions during September and October, since most applications are due at the end of October or mid-November. However, summer sessions and last-minute sessions are welcome.
